The purpose of this position is to collect data for analysis by end users to interpret patterns and trends. Support, create or modify computer applications programs and report formats.
This class works under general supervision, independently developing work methods and sequences.
Discusses computer programs, data summarization and report form output requirements, and recommends changes to improve format, use, efficiency and utilization of reports.
Reviews purpose and content of reports to improve format and use.
Prepares statistical reports and cost analysis on projects, grants, department programs or operations, or research findings.
Generates and distributes computer reports and system status reports on department activity and operations for management purposes.
Searches computer records and files to display or report information or to respond to inquiries for information.
Researches computer manuals, periodicals and technical reports to develop computer programs and information systems to meet current and future user requirements, and conducts special projects.
Coordinates with Metro computer professionals to obtain assistance in correcting system errors or notifies vendors to request service or repair.
Communicates computer data storage, network and programming activities with computer professionals.
Supports, creates or modifies computer applications programs and report formats.
Creates and maintains data extraction for multiple sources and data structures for internal and external groups.
Creates applications programs, database queries and extracts data from embedded websites for end user ad-hoc reporting.
Performs related work as assigned.
MINIMUM E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S
Associate’s Degree in Computer Science, Engineering Technology or related discipline.
One (1) year of programming or data system operations experience
or
An equivalent combination of education, training and experience.
OTHER M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S
Must be a U.S. Citizen.
Must be of good moral character, with no criminal or felony record inconsistent with the provisions of this paragraph. Unacceptable will be persons who have been convicted of a felony, or who have any criminal action pending against them.
An applicant may be disqualified for multiple misdemeanors, an unacceptable criminal record, or multiple traffic violations.
Must submit to a pre-employment drug screening.
Must submit to a pre-employment polygraph test.
Must be on 24-hour call.
Must submit to fingerprinting for criminal history check.
Applicants who have illegally bought or used marijuana, including medicinal cannabis, within six months of application will be disqualified.
Applicants who have illegally sold marijuana, including medicinal cannabis, within one year of application will be disqualified.
Applicants who have illegally bought, sold, or used any controlled substance or narcotic drug, other than marijuana, without a prescription within six years of application will be disqualified.
